This installation draws inspiration from Eastern philosophy and the duality of war and peace. The spine, a central motif, symbolizes both the strength and vulnerability inherent in human existence. By integrating this element into the form of a bow and arrow—a universal emblem of conflict—Zhanjun Shen highlights the preciousness of peace and the dignity of life. The work also incorporates spiritual references from Eastern Buddhism, infusing the piece with deeper religious and philosophical significance.
Bow and Arrow distinguishes itself through its innovative reinterpretation of traditional forms. The design subverts expectations by merging the anatomical structure of the spine with the classic silhouette of the bow. Replaceable arrowheads, each shaped like the Four Heavenly Kings from Buddhist tradition, add layers of meaning and invite contemplation on the cycles of violence and harmony. This modular approach not only enhances the artwork’s interactivity but also allows for a personalized experience, deepening the viewer’s engagement with its themes.
The realization of this piece showcases exceptional craftsmanship and technological precision. High-quality stainless steel is meticulously cut and polished to achieve a refined, tactile finish. The arrowheads are produced using advanced carving techniques, resulting in intricate, durable forms that capture the essence of their spiritual inspiration. The robust yet elegant construction ensures both aesthetic appeal and functional integrity, reflecting the artist’s obsessive attention to detail.
Measuring 1900 mm by 300 mm by 1900 mm, the installation commands presence while inviting interaction. Users can easily switch out the arrowheads, adapting the artwork to different contexts or personal interpretations. This flexibility not only enhances the practicality of the piece but also fosters a deeper understanding of its underlying messages. Through this hands-on engagement, viewers are encouraged to contemplate the broader implications of war, peace, and the shared destiny of humanity.
Bow and Arrow has garnered recognition for its thoughtful integration of cultural heritage and modern innovation, earning the Iron A' Fine Arts and Art Installation Design Award in 2025.
